前言:之前在网上找的好多都是基于vue-cli 2.x的,而使用vue-cli 3的文章比较少, Vue CLI 3 中文文档,所以我在自己尝试的时候把几篇文章结合了一下,调出来了我想要的模式,也就是Vue CLI 3 + element-ui + 多个二次封装的组件。最终想要 ...
两年多的彷徨 迷茫。最终又回归初心,回归前端开发。这次部门给我安排的任务是,做一个公司自己的组件库。计划争取把做组件库的每个关键过程 记录下来,给 大家,给 自己 提供有用的帮助。 不多说了,切入正题。 提到组件库,最先想到的就是element ui, 我也是先那 它 做的demo实现。 先说思路了,最初的思路是,先把element ui 组件库下载来,修改其中的组件 然后 打包 放到 npm上 ...
2020-07-09 16:33 2 1540 推荐指数:
前言:之前在网上找的好多都是基于vue-cli 2.x的,而使用vue-cli 3的文章比较少, Vue CLI 3 中文文档,所以我在自己尝试的时候把几篇文章结合了一下,调出来了我想要的模式,也就是Vue CLI 3 + element-ui + 多个二次封装的组件。最终想要 ...
首先,使用过element-ui的table组建的同学都知道,每次使用的时候表头字段都要一个一个的去写,写起来很麻烦,既不美观又浪费时间,基于以上原因,对table组件进行二次封装,使我们在使用的时候更加简单方便。 这里只是简单的封装,同学们若是感兴趣可以加以完善,若有问题可以一起讨论 ...
新建 Pagination 页面中使用 ...
前端组件 strUtil.js 后端接口 ...
element-ui表格封装的非常好,由于最近工作负责基础组件封装,封装更适合公司业务的复用组件,从表格开始: 源码链接:表格组件 组件源码:Table.vue View Code 页面调用和搜索框组件同用 最终效果: ...
源码链接:查询表单组件 组件源码:searchForm.vue View Code 组件调用:index.vue,组合table 运行效果: ...
源码链接:树形菜单组件 使用时: ...
源码:编辑表单组件 组件源码(待优化)editForm.vue: View Code 页面调用:该组件嵌在弹窗组件之中,所以和之前的弹窗组件一样 最终运行效果: 补充说明: 本篇文章是我基于element-ui制作脚手架项目 ...